Your role We're seeking a passionate and driven Product Manager/ Owner (Magento) to take our e-commerce platform to the next level. In this role, you will manage our Magento-based shop platform from both a business and product perspective, acting as the key product manager within a dynamic, cross-functional team of engineers, QA, and UX designers. You'll lead the end-to-end development of new features—from initial discovery to successful delivery—using data-driven analysis to uncover opportunities and guide your decisions. As the ultimate go-to person for all e-commerce shop topics (spanning search, recommendations, checkout, conversion optimization, and LLM experimentation), you will coordinate seamlessly across teams and stakeholders. By planning six to twelve months ahead, you will help define and shape our long-term product strategy and roadmap, always keeping an eye on what comes next for our digital experience. The lack of natural, high-quality products on the market was the original motivation for founding Sunday Natural in 2013. We aim to produce the products we ourselves would love to buy – as natural as possible, absolutely pure, free from any additives, and of the highest quality. In a strategic partnership with CVC, Sunday Natural is now one of Germany's most renowned quality manufacturers, with its own research and development department in Berlin. For the continuous improvement of our products, we collaborate with selected research institutes, scientists, therapists, farmers, and professional associations. We take our ecological responsibility very seriously: that’s why the majority of our product range is vegan. We also take an innovative approach to packaging: most of our products are packaged in glass, making them almost entirely recyclable. Our diverse team in Berlin consists of over 350 employees from more than 40 nationalities and continues to grow – but at a sustainable pace.
